javascript hit counter
Business, Financial News, U.S and International Breaking News

Sluggish apps in your M1 Mac? Verify this primary for a attainable repair

There is no doubt about it. The M1 Macs are a formidable evolutionary change within the 30-year historical past of the Macintosh pc. Whereas the M1 has some limitations (notably in reminiscence capability and ports), total worth/efficiency has been distinctive.

See additionally: Migrating from Intel iMac to M1 MacBook Air: My five-day journey

However, when you’ve upgraded lately from an Intel Mac (notably when you used the Migration Device), you might need discovered that some favourite purposes appear extra sluggish than you keep in mind. Even when you’re working an Apple Silicon Mac with a contemporary set up, you might end up groaning in regards to the efficiency of some purposes.

Thankfully, there could also be a repair. M1 Macs have a central processing unit (what we normally name “the processor”) that is essentially completely different from that of Intel-based Macs. Applications written for Intel processors had been compiled to supply Intel instruction set code, which then ran natively on the Intel processors.

Apple had finished this processor structure leap earlier than when it moved from PowerPC-based machines to Intel-based machines. At the moment, it embedded Rosetta’s expertise into OS X that emulated PowerPC directions on the Intel machines.

See additionally: Migrating to M1 Macs: How I am upgrading my small fleet of older Apple desktops and laptops.

Apple repeated this technological feat this time, with Rosetta 2 on MacOS. Rosetta 2 interprets packages whose binary code is meant to run on Intel x86 processors in order that they’ll run on Apple Silicon M1 processors.

Typically talking, this translation/interpretation mechanism works fairly properly. However as a result of there’s additional processing on the a part of the CPU to do all the interpretation/interpretation, it makes use of up processor cycles, slowing down execution as in comparison with purposes that natively run on Apple Silicon.

See additionally: How a lot does it value to personal a small fleet of Macs? The whole value of possession is defined.

And that is the place our repair is available in. It’s possible you’ll be working non-native, emulated Intel-based legacy builds of an utility when you would be working a lot quicker native variations of that utility.

This is how one can discover out

MacOS features a mechanism for locating out the native/emulated standing for all of your put in purposes. Go to the Apple menu and choose About This Mac. Then click on the System Report button. A brand new window will open with an enormous quantity of helpful information about your system.

On the left, there are three foremost classes: {Hardware}, Community, and Software program. In the event you do not see something below these headings, click on the little triangle twisty to open up a subordinate checklist. Below Software program, search for Functions, and click on on that. Give the machine a minute or two to construct the related desk.

Within the right-hand pane, you may see a listing of purposes after which some particulars in regards to the high utility. Far more of the window is dedicated to the appliance’s particulars, however you’ll be able to drag the splitter bar all the way down to showcase extra of the appliance checklist. That is the place we’ll be working.

macbook-air-2021-09-02-00-50-43.jpg

Right here, you may see 5 columns. We’re involved with the primary column (Software Identify) and the fifth column (Form). Let us take a look at that Form column for a minute. Discover it has listings together with Common, Intel, Apple Silicon, Different, and some which are listed as 32-bit (Unsupported).

Any utility listed as 32-bit (Unsupported) will merely not run. It’s best to most likely replace or uninstall these.

What we’re on the lookout for, although, are the purposes listed as Intel. Not like the purposes listed as Apple Silicon or Common (which means they assist each forms of binaries), purposes listed as Intel are solely working the x86 instruction set in emulated mode.

These are the slower purposes.

If the appliance you are discovering sluggish reveals as Intel, then that is your drawback. I discovered that whereas some purposes swap to Common when up to date, many do not.

Chrome, for instance, was disturbingly sluggish after I migrated to my M1 MacBook Air. I attempted updating it, however it stayed as an Intel binary. I needed to uninstall it, then set up a contemporary binary to get the velocity improve.

That is most likely what you may must do. Pay explicit consideration to backing up settings and managing licenses, then uninstall the Intel utility. Most frequently, when you obtain now, you may straight get an M1 native utility. However you would possibly wish to poke round no matter web site you are taking a look at to your distribution to make sure that you are both getting a Common or Apple Silicon-based binary.

And that is it. Once I up to date these Intel-based purposes that had been annoying me (notably Chrome), I went from ugh to wow. It was well worth the few additional minutes of system upkeep for such an improved consumer expertise.

In fact, not all purposes have Apple Silicon binaries. You may both should stay with it or foyer the builders to do a port for these.

What about you? Are you working an M1 Mac? Have you ever discovered a giant increase whenever you transfer to a local binary? Have you ever been capable of enhance efficiency utilizing this tip? Tell us within the feedback under.


You’ll be able to observe my day-to-day mission updates on social media. Remember to observe me on Twitter at @DavidGewirtz, on Fb at Fb.com/DavidGewirtz, on Instagram at Instagram.com/DavidGewirtz, and on YouTube at YouTube.com/DavidGewirtzTV.

Supply

Comments are closed.